Company Overview:

NISC develops and implements enterprise-level and customer-facing software solutions for over 960+ energy cooperatives and communication organizations across North America. Our mission is to deliver technology solutions and services that are Member-focused, quality-driven and valued-priced. We exist to serve our Members and help them serve their communities through our innovative software products, services and outstanding customer support. Primary Responsibilities:

NISC is looking for passionate engineers to add to our Platform team to push our solutions to their fullest potential. You'll work with a team of talented engineers to evolve our platform, used by hundreds of application developers to build, deploy, and run thousands of services.

Essential Functions:

  • Complete complex software maintenance and enhancements independently
  • Analyze and translate advanced level user requirements and design into software, with a focus on multiple areas of the solution
  • Research, analyze, and resolve moderately complex issues and bugs.
  • Work closely with development teams to research, design, and implement new features.
  • Follow industry and organizational best practices
  • Keep up with technology trends and innovations in your field of practice.
  • Other duties as assigned

Desired Experience and Skills:

  • Generally, requires 10+ years' experience in software development or infrastructure
  • Proficient with Python and Terraform
  • Proficient with Git
  • Experience with Java, Springboot, Gradle
  • Experience with Linux
  • Experience with build pipeline tools (Bamboo)
  • Experience with building and running containers (Docker)
  • Experience with cloud providers (AWS)
  • Working knowledge of deploying and maintaining Kubernetes clusters
